Twisha Sharma case: Hubby Samarth Singh and mother-in-law remanded in judicial custody

Date:

BHOPAL: A court in Bhopal on Tuesday remanded late model Twisha Sharma’s husband, Samarth Singh and mother-in-law Giribala Singh, both accused of dowry harassment, in judicial custody for 14 days on completion of their CBI remand.

Twisha was found hanging in her marital home in Bhopal on May 12.

The CBI produced Samarth Singh and his mother, a retired district judge, in the court of Shobhna Bhalave, after completion of their remand, following which they were sent in judicial custody till June 16, said Twisha’s family lawyer, Ankur Pandey
